Message type: E = Error
Message class: FOPCB - MIC: Customizing Messages
Message number: 350
Message text: **** Roles for Person Responsible ***

- **** Roles for Person Responsible *** ?The SAP error message FOPCB350, which relates to "Roles for Person Responsible," typically occurs in the context of SAP's Financial Accounting (FI) or Controlling (CO) modules, particularly when dealing with master data or transaction data that requires a person responsible to be assigned specific roles.
Cause:
The error message FOPCB350 usually indicates that there is an issue with the assignment of roles to a person responsible in the system. This can happen due to several reasons, including:
- Missing Role Assignment: The person responsible does not have the necessary roles assigned in the system.
- Incorrect Role Configuration: The roles assigned may not be configured correctly or may not meet the requirements for the transaction being processed.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to assign or view the roles for the person responsible.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data related to the person responsible.
Solution:
To resolve the FOPCB350 error, you can take the following steps:
Check Role Assignments:
- Navigate to the relevant transaction or master data where the error occurred.
- Verify that the person responsible has the appropriate roles assigned. This can typically be done in the user management or role management sections of SAP.
Review Role Configuration:
- Ensure that the roles assigned to the person responsible are correctly configured and meet the requirements for the specific transaction or process.
Authorization Check:
- Ensure that the user attempting to perform the action has the necessary authorizations to view and assign roles. This may require coordination with your SAP security team.
Data Consistency Check:
- Check for any inconsistencies in the master data related to the person responsible. This may involve reviewing the relevant tables or using transaction codes like SE16 or SE11 to inspect the data.
